How to build a destination-specific vaccination plan

Start by mapping your trip to real risk factors: rural versus urban travel, likelihood of animal contact, expected healthcare access, water and food exposure, and time spent outdoors. Then compare your personal profile—age, previous vaccines, immune conditions, and any medication—against destination guidance.
